[MacPorts] #65147: nettle fails to build for x86_64 with gcc10-bootstrap: sha256-compress.asm:208:no such instruction

MacPorts noreply at macports.org
Tue May 10 03:02:03 UTC 2022


#65147: nettle fails to build for x86_64 with gcc10-bootstrap:
sha256-compress.asm:208:no such instruction
---------------------------+---------------------------------
  Reporter:  barracuda156  |      Owner:  ryandesign
      Type:  defect        |     Status:  assigned
  Priority:  Normal        |  Milestone:
 Component:  ports         |    Version:  2.7.2
Resolution:                |   Keywords:  x86_64, snowleopard
      Port:  nettle        |
---------------------------+---------------------------------

Comment (by barracuda156):

 So back to the ticket issue: `nettle` fails with `gcc11` :(
 {{{
 /opt/x86_64/bin/gcc-mp-11 -I. -I/opt/x86_64/include -DHAVE_CONFIG_H -pipe
 -Os -arch x86_64 -ggdb3 -Wall -W -Wno-sign-compare   -Wmissing-prototypes
 -Wmissing-declarations -Wstrict-prototypes   -Wpointer-arith -Wbad-
 function-cast -Wnested-externs -fPIC -MT sha256-compress-2.o -MD -MP -MF
 sha256-compress-2.o.d -c sha256-compress-2.s
 /opt/x86_64/bin/gcc-mp-11 -I. -I/opt/x86_64/include -DHAVE_CONFIG_H -pipe
 -Os -arch x86_64 -ggdb3 -Wall -W -Wno-sign-compare   -Wmissing-prototypes
 -Wmissing-declarations -Wstrict-prototypes   -Wpointer-arith -Wbad-
 function-cast -Wnested-externs -fPIC -MT sha1-compress-2.o -MD -MP -MF
 sha1-compress-2.o.d -c sha1-compress-2.s
 sha1-compress.asm:73:no such instruction: `sha1rnds4 $0, %xmm5,%xmm4'
 sha1-compress.asm:78:no such instruction: `sha1nexte %xmm1, %xmm6'
 sha1-compress.asm:80:no such instruction: `sha1rnds4 $0, %xmm6,%xmm4'
 sha1-compress.asm:81:no such instruction: `sha1msg1 %xmm1, %xmm0'
 sha1-compress.asm:86:no such instruction: `sha1nexte %xmm2, %xmm5'
 sha1-compress.asm:88:no such instruction: `sha1rnds4 $0, %xmm5,%xmm4'
 sha1-compress.asm:89:no such instruction: `sha1msg1 %xmm2, %xmm1'
 sha1-compress.asm:96:no such instruction: `sha1nexte %xmm3, %xmm6'
 sha1-compress.asm:98:no such instruction: `sha1msg2 %xmm3, %xmm0'
 sha1-compress.asm:99:no such instruction: `sha1rnds4 $0, %xmm6,%xmm4'
 sha1-compress.asm:100:no such instruction: `sha1msg1 %xmm3, %xmm2'
 sha1-compress.asm:104:no such instruction: `sha1nexte %xmm0, %xmm5'
 sha1-compress.asm:106:no such instruction: `sha1msg2 %xmm0, %xmm1'
 sha1-compress.asm:107:no such instruction: `sha1rnds4 $0, %xmm5,%xmm4'
 sha1-compress.asm:108:no such instruction: `sha1msg1 %xmm0, %xmm3'
 sha1-compress.asm:113:no such instruction: `sha1nexte %xmm1, %xmm6'
 sha1-compress.asm:115:no such instruction: `sha1msg2 %xmm1, %xmm2'
 sha1-compress.asm:116:no such instruction: `sha1rnds4 $1, %xmm6,%xmm4'
 sha1-compress.asm:117:no such instruction: `sha1msg1 %xmm1, %xmm0'
 sha1-compress.asm:121:no such instruction: `sha1nexte %xmm2, %xmm5'
 sha1-compress.asm:123:no such instruction: `sha1msg2 %xmm2, %xmm3'
 sha1-compress.asm:124:no such instruction: `sha1rnds4 $1, %xmm5,%xmm4'
 sha1-compress.asm:125:no such instruction: `sha1msg1 %xmm2, %xmm1'
 sha1-compress.asm:129:no such instruction: `sha1nexte %xmm3, %xmm6'
 sha1-compress.asm:131:no such instruction: `sha1msg2 %xmm3, %xmm0'
 sha1-compress.asm:132:no such instruction: `sha1rnds4 $1, %xmm6,%xmm4'
 sha1-compress.asm:133:no such instruction: `sha1msg1 %xmm3, %xmm2'
 sha1-compress.asm:137:no such instruction: `sha1nexte %xmm0, %xmm5'
 sha1-compress.asm:139:no such instruction: `sha1msg2 %xmm0, %xmm1'
 sha1-compress.asm:140:no such instruction: `sha1rnds4 $1, %xmm5,%xmm4'
 sha1-compress.asm:141:no such instruction: `sha1msg1 %xmm0, %xmm3'
 sha1-compress.asm:145:no such instruction: `sha1nexte %xmm1, %xmm6'
 sha1-compress.asm:147:no such instruction: `sha1msg2 %xmm1, %xmm2'
 sha1-compress.asm:148:no such instruction: `sha1rnds4 $1, %xmm6,%xmm4'
 sha1-compress.asm:149:no such instruction: `sha1msg1 %xmm1, %xmm0'
 sha1-compress.asm:154:no such instruction: `sha1nexte %xmm2, %xmm5'
 sha1-compress.asm:156:no such instruction: `sha1msg2 %xmm2, %xmm3'
 sha1-compress.asm:157:no such instruction: `sha1rnds4 $2, %xmm5,%xmm4'
 sha1-compress.asm:158:no such instruction: `sha1msg1 %xmm2, %xmm1'
 sha256-compress.asm:87: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:89: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ha1-compress.asm:162:sha256-compress.asm:96:no such instruction:
 `sha1nexte %xmm3, %xmm6'
 no such instruction: `sha256rnds2 %xmm5, %xmm6'sha1-compress.asm:164:no
 such instruction: `sha1msg2 %xmm3, %xmm0'
 sha1-compress.asm:165:no such instruction: `sha1rnds4 $2, %xmm6,%xmm4'
 sha1-compress.asm:166:no such instruction: `sha1msg1 %xmm3, %xmm2'

 sha256-compress.asm:98: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:99:no such instruction: `sha256msg1 %xmm2, %xmm1'
 sha256-compress.asm:106: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:108: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:109:no such instruction: `sha256msg1 %xmm3, %xmm2'
 sha256-compress.asm:117: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:119: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:123:no such instruction: `sha256msg2 %xmm4, %xmm1'
 sha256-compress.asm:124:no such instruction: `sha256msg1 %xmm4, %xmm3'
 sha256-compress.asm:129: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:131: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:135:no such instruction: `sha256msg2 %xmm1, %xmm2'
 sha256-compress.asm:136:no such instruction: `sha256msg1 %xmm1, %xmm4'
 sha256-compress.asm:141: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:143: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:147:no such instruction: `sha256msg2 %xmm2, %xmm3'
 sha256-compress.asm:148:no such instruction: `sha256msg1 %xmm2, %xmm1'
 sha256-compress.asm:153: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:155: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:159:no such instruction: `sha256msg2 %xmm3, %xmm4'
 sha256-compress.asm:160:no such instruction: `sha256msg1 %xmm3, %xmm2'
 sha256-compress.asm:165: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:167: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:171:no such instruction: `sha256msg2 %xmm4, %xmm1'
 sha256-compress.asm:172:no such instruction: `sha256msg1 %xmm4, %xmm3'
 sha256-compress.asm:177: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:179: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:183:no such instruction: `sha256msg2 %xmm1, %xmm2'
 sha256-compress.asm:184:no such instruction: `sha256msg1 %xmm1, %xmm4'
 sha256-compress.asm:189: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:191: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:195:no such instruction: `sha256msg2 %xmm2, %xmm3'
 sha256-compress.asm:196:no such instruction: `sha256msg1 %xmm2, %xmm1'
 sha256-compress.asm:201: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:203: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:207:no such instruction: `sha256msg2 %xmm3, %xmm4'
 sha256-compress.asm:208:no such instruction: `sha256msg1 %xmm3, %xmm2'
 sha256-compress.asm:213: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:215: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:219:no such instruction: `sha256msg2 %xmm4, %xmm1'
 sha256-compress.asm:220:no such instruction: `sha256msg1 %xmm4, %xmm3'
 sha256-compress.asm:225: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:227: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:231:no such instruction: `sha256msg2 %xmm1, %xmm2'
 sha256-compress.asm:232:no such instruction: `sha256msg1 %xmm1, %xmm4'
 sha256-compress.asm:237: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:239: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:243:no such instruction: `sha256msg2 %xmm2, %xmm3'
 sha256-compress.asm:247: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:249: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ha256-compress.asm:253:no such instruction: `sha256msg2 %xmm3, %xmm4'
 sha256-compress.asm:257:no such instruction: `sha256rnds2 %xmm5, %xmm6'
 sha256-compress.asm:259:no such instruction: `sha256rnds2 %xmm6, %xmm5'
 sha1-compress.asm:170:no such instruction: `sha1nexte %xmm0, %xmm5'
 sha1-compress.asm:172:no such instruction: `sha1msg2 %xmm0, %xmm1'
 sha1-compress.asm:173:no such instruction: `sha1rnds4 $2, %xmm5,%xmm4'
 sha1-compress.asm:174:no such instruction: `sha1msg1 %xmm0, %xmm3'
 sha1-compress.asm:178:no such instruction: `sha1nexte %xmm1, %xmm6'
 sha1-compress.asm:180:no such instruction: `sha1msg2 %xmm1, %xmm2'
 sha1-compress.asm:181:no such instruction: `sha1rnds4 $2, %xmm6,%xmm4'
 sha1-compress.asm:182:no such instruction: `sha1msg1 %xmm1, %xmm0'
 sha1-compress.asm:186:no such instruction: `sha1nexte %xmm2, %xmm5'
 sha1-compress.asm:188:no such instruction: `sha1msg2 %xmm2, %xmm3'
 sha1-compress.asm:189:no such instruction: `sha1rnds4 $2, %xmm5,%xmm4'
 sha1-compress.asm:190:no such instruction: `sha1msg1 %xmm2, %xmm1'
 sha1-compress.asm:195:no such instruction: `sha1nexte %xmm3, %xmm6'
 sha1-compress.asm:197:no such instruction: `sha1msg2 %xmm3, %xmm0'
 sha1-compress.asm:198:no such instruction: `sha1rnds4 $3, %xmm6,%xmm4'
 sha1-compress.asm:199:no such instruction: `sha1msg1 %xmm3, %xmm2'
 sha1-compress.asm:203:no such instruction: `sha1nexte %xmm0, %xmm5'
 sha1-compress.asm:205:no such instruction: `sha1msg2 %xmm0, %xmm1'
 sha1-compress.asm:206:no such instruction: `sha1rnds4 $3, %xmm5,%xmm4'
 sha1-compress.asm:207:no such instruction: `sha1msg1 %xmm0, %xmm3'
 sha1-compress.asm:211:no such instruction: `sha1nexte %xmm1, %xmm6'
 sha1-compress.asm:213:no such instruction: `sha1msg2 %xmm1, %xmm2'
 sha1-compress.asm:214:no such instruction: `sha1rnds4 $3, %xmm6,%xmm4'
 sha1-compress.asm:217:no such instruction: `sha1nexte %xmm2, %xmm5'
 sha1-compress.asm:219:no such instruction: `sha1msg2 %xmm2, %xmm3'
 sha1-compress.asm:220:no such instruction: `sha1rnds4 $3, %xmm5,%xmm4'
 sha1-compress.asm:222:no such instruction: `sha1nexte %xmm3, %xmm6'
 sha1-compress.asm:224:no such instruction: `sha1rnds4 $3, %xmm6,%xmm4'
 sha1-compress.asm:226:no such instruction: `sha1nexte %xmm8, %xmm5'
 make[1]: *** [sha1-compress-2.o] Error 1
 make[1]: *** Waiting for unfinished jobs....
 make[1]: *** [sha256-compress-2.o] Error 1
 make[1]: Leaving directory
 `/opt/x86_64/var/macports/build/_opt_x86_64_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_devel_nettle/nettle/work/nettle-3.7.3'
 make: *** [all] Error 2
 make: Leaving directory
 `/opt/x86_64/var/macports/build/_opt_x86_64_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_devel_nettle/nettle/work/nettle-3.7.3'
 Command failed:  cd
 "/opt/x86_64/var/macports/build/_opt_x86_64_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_devel_nettle/nettle/work/nettle-3.7.3"
 && /usr/bin/make -j4 -w all
 Exit code: 2
 }}}

-- 
Ticket URL: <https://trac.macports.org/ticket/65147#comment:13>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list